The United Football League (UFL) announced a partnership today with Bolt6, a company at the forefront of sports technology innovation. This alliance will see the integration of Bolt6's cutting-edge TrU Line Technology into UFL games, elevating the precision of ball-spotting and augmenting the overall experience for athletes, officials, and fans alike. The UFL is set to launch as the premier spring football platform, formed by the merging of the XFL and USFL in 2024

IoT Solutions World Congress 2024 will showcase the latest in industry transformation from 21-23 May 2024 in Barcelona, Spain. There will be 125 talks at the event, structured around four topics: technology-enabled transformation, climate change and sustainability, regulations and standards, and cybersecurity.

Yemen’s Houthis attacked a Chinese oil tanker with multiple ballistic missiles. The US Central Command (Centcom) said the ship launched four anti-ship missiles into the Red Sea. No casualties were reported, and a fire on board was extinguished within 30 minutes.

Michael Simeone will oversee the city’s technology budget and help integrate technology initiatives across the city. As chief technology officer, he will also work with Superintendent Madeline Negron. His appointment follows a business email compromise last June in which hackers stole $5.9 million in city funds related to a New Haven Public Schools bus contract.

Kaynes Semicon is close to receiving approval on its chip assembly and test – OSAT unit in Telangana under the government’s Rs 76,000 crore semiconductor incentive scheme. In October last year, Kaynes announced its plans to invest Rs 2,800 crore in the OSAT facility. The company has already started construction at the plant.

Bangalore Water Supply and Sewerage Board (BWSSB) has decided to use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Internet of Things (IoT) technologies for efficient borewell management. Of the around 14,000 public borewells in Bengaluru, nearly 6,900 have already dried up this summer.

Stadler’s FLIRT H2 is the hydrogen-powered model of its popular commuter trainset. It ran for a total of 46 hours, completing 2,803km (1,741.7 miles), on a single tank of fuel. The train is being tested in the US before deployment with the San Bernardino County Transportation Authority (SBCTA) in California.
